Located on the picturesque Bruntsfield links in Edinburgh, we are proud to be Scotland's first dedicated grilled cheese outlet. Indulge in our gooey grilled cheese sandwiches made with soft sourdough bread baked fresh each morning and a variety of tantalizing cheese and fillings. Enjoy the open outlook as you savor your meal and wash it down with a smooth Hasbean coffee or fair-trade Karma Kola. Both sit-in and takeaway options are available for your convenience.

Nestled in the heart of Edinburgh, this restaurant offers a tempting array of toasties that has garnered a mix of reactions from patrons. While some diners rave about the flavorful cheese-filled creations, others express disappointment in service and certain menu items, such as the breakfast burrito and much-maligned chili toastie. Despite the inconsistent experiences, the warm, gooey Mac and cheese melts and hearty Philly cheesesteaks impress many visitors. Although the ambiance is minimalistic and lacking in seating, the promise of comfort food at reasonable prices continues to draw customers back for a satisfying, casual lunch experience.
